battery cells vs motor kv
I have Castle Sidewinder sct with 1410 motor. As a combo it can run 2s. ESC can run up to 3s but with motor with lower kv. Question is: what can happen if will plug more cells that it's recommended (for eg. 3s to standard setup)?

The main risk is likely too much current/amps for the ESC, causing it fail. Traces on the boards, the transistors, etc, something will be irreversibly damaged. Known as letting out the magic smoke!
In general, higher voltage drives an increase in current. Also higher kV motors take more current low kV. At some point the combination exceeds what the ESC is capable of.
